ovn-ctl: add support for SSL nb/sb db connections
Add support for SSL connections to OVN northbound and/or southbound databases. To improve security, the NB and SB ovsdb daemons no longer have open ptcp connections by default. This is a change in behavior from previous versions, users wishing to use TCP connections to the NB/SB daemons can either request that a passive TCP connection be used via ovn-ctl command-line options (e.g. via OVN_CTL_OPTS/OVN_NORTHD_OPTS in startup scripts): --db-sb-create-insecure-remote=yes --db-nb-create-insecure-remote=yes Or configure a connection after the NB/SB daemons have been started, e.g.: ovn-sbctl set-connection ptcp:6642 ovn-nbctl set-connection ptcp:6641 Users desiring SSL database connections will need to generate certificates and private key as described in INSTALL.SSL.rst and perform the following one-time configuration steps: ovn-sbctl set-ssl <private-key> <certificate> <ca-cert> ovn-sbctl set-connection pssl:6642 ovn-nbctl set-ssl <private-key> <certificate> <ca-cert> ovn-nbctl set-connection pssl:6641 On the ovn-controller and ovn-controller-vtep side, SSL configuration must be provided on the command-line when the daemons are started, this should be provided via the following command-line options (e.g. via OVN_CTL_OPTS/OVN_CONTROLLER_OPTS in startup scripts): --ovn-controller-ssl-key=<private-key> --ovn-controller-ssl-cert=<certificate> --ovn-controller-ssl-ca-cert=<ca-cert> The SB database connection should also be configured to use SSL, e.g.: ovs-vsctl set Open_vSwitch . \ external-ids:ovn-remote=ssl:w.x.y.z:6642 Acked-by: Ben Pfaff <blp@ovn.org> Signed-off-by: Lance Richardson <lrichard@redhat.com> Signed-off-by: Ben Pfaff <blp@ovn.org>
